Nice Behavior and Its Impact
Recent studies highlight how acts of kindness and being nice can dramatically improve mental health both for the giver and the receiver. In a research conducted by Harvard University, participants who engaged in kind acts reported lower levels of anxiety and depression. This phenomenon is often referred to as the ‘helper’s high,’ stating that those who do nice things for others tend to feel better about themselves as well.
Moreover, being nice can enhance professional relationships and promote collaboration. In workplace environments, employees who practice nice behaviors tend to have stronger team dynamics and increased productivity. According to a Gallup survey, teams that prioritize kindness and mutual respect were more likely to be high-performing.
